The tour kicks off with a pickup at Heritage Westlake Apartment or directly at Tuan Chau Harbor, where the cruise begins at Cafe Ong Bau inside the harbor. The convenience of hotel pickup is appreciated, especially after a long journey or if you’re not keen on navigating local transport. For those opting for the transfer, the ride sets the tone for a relaxed day ahead, with a chance to spot some of the rural scenery en route.
Once aboard the luxury vessel, you’ll be greeted by friendly crew members offering a welcome drink. The boat’s interior is designed to deliver comfort along with style — expect plush seating, spacious decks for viewing, and attentive service. As the boat departs, you’ll cruise past iconic landmarks like Stone Dog, Stone Incense Burner, and the Kissing Rocks — natural formations that are perfect for photos and provide a scenic backdrop that’s instantly recognizable.
From 12:00 to around 13:15, a buffet lunch is served in the cruise’s elegant restaurant area. The highlight here is the seafood, which many reviewers say is fresh and skillfully prepared, offering a taste of local flavors with a luxury touch. The buffet layout allows for variety, accommodating different tastes and dietary preferences.
Post-lunch, the tour heads to Sung Sot Cave, known as the largest and most stunning of the caves in Halong Bay. From reviews, guides often describe the cave as “amazing” and “massive,” with impressive stalactites and stalagmites that create a surreal landscape. Expect about an hour of exploration, with guides providing insights into the cave’s formations and history.

Next, you’ll visit Luon Cave, where the options for exploration include kayaking or riding a bamboo boat rowed by local residents. This stop offers a hands-on experience, allowing you to get closer to the limestone cliffs and enjoy the tranquility of the bay. Many reviewers appreciate the opportunity to paddle through the calm waters and see the surrounding scenery from a different perspective.
From around 15:30 to 16:30, the boat visits Titop Island. The highlight here is hiking to the top of the island’s viewpoint, which offers panoramic vistas over Halong Bay. The climb isn’t difficult, and the reward is well worth the effort — many reviewers comment on how stunning the views are, especially near sunset. The beach area is also perfect for a quick dip if you want to cool off before heading back.
Another stop is Hang Luon Cave, part of Bo Hon Island. Known as a location with “amazing things”, the cave is accessible by boat, and visitors often find it an intriguing spot for photos. The area surrounding the cave features notable islands like Turtle Island and Heaven Gate, adding to the scenic richness of the visit.

Is pickup included in this tour?
Yes, if you select the transfer option, a private car will pick you up from your hotel in the Halong area. You can also choose to meet directly at Tuan Chau Harbor.
What is the duration of the cruise?
The entire experience lasts approximately 6 hours, from pickup or meeting at the harbor to returning after the last stop.
Does the tour include meals?
Yes, a buffet lunch featuring seafood and local flavors is included, served on the cruise.
Are entrance fees included?
All entrance fees for caves and islands visited during the tour are covered in the ticket price.
Can I do activities like kayaking?
Absolutely, kayaking or bamboo boat rides are part of the itinerary, offering a closer look at the bay’s caves and scenery.
What should I bring?
Bring comfortable clothes, sun protection, a camera, and perhaps a swimsuit if you want to swim or relax on the beach.
Is this tour suitable for children?
Most travelers can participate, but it’s best for those who are comfortable with walking, climbing, and a full day on the water.
What if I want to cancel or reschedule?
Cancellation is free if done at least 24 hours in advance. Short-notice changes are not accepted, so plan accordingly.
